Parisian Coco Merchant Timpani, Engraved Pewter, Louis XV Period
Artist: François Laumosnier, 1748, 1775.
Festive tumbler, traveling coco water sellers used it, tulip-shaped pewter with gadrooned pedestal, this one richly engraved with a rotating decoration: Large flowers, beautiful girl on horseback carrying refreshments, pagoda bell tower, young girl on slipper. Wheel engraved border top and bottom. Hallmarks on bottom: 3 letters under crown, Parisian hallmark of François Laumosnier, 1748, 1775.
Height: 12 cm, Diam: 9cm.
Good condition, little wear, no scratches.
